Subject: Quickstore 4.2 — bloom filter now fronts the KV layer

Plugin authors: starting with this release, Quickstore places a bloom filter ahead of the key-value store. Negative lookups return faster; false positives fall through safely. No API changes are required on your side. Verify your plugin against the staging build referenced below.

session token of fahif-tadup = htk3_9c7

- [ ] **Step 7: Breaker override escrow.** After sealing the signing keys for the Tallgrove upstream API circuit breaker, confirm the support team can force the breaker open during a full outage. The override bundle lives in the sealed escrow drawer and is useless without its unlock phrase. Two ceremony witnesses must initial this step before proceeding. The escrow bundle is decrypted with the recovery passphrase that follows.

vault phrase of kahip-kahop = holath-quenmir

Subject: Key rotation — Ordersafe soft-delete service

Team, ahead of the weekly sync: we rotated the credentials for the Ordersafe service that manages soft deletes in the orders table. As a reminder, rows flagged deleted_at are retained for 90 days before the purge job removes them, and the service enforces that window. The old key stops working Friday at noon. All consumers should update their configs before then. For convenience, the new key for the service follows here.

API key for yahig-tadup: kto7_ubizbYm

Minutes — Management Meeting, Korrel Foods Ltd

Present: R. Vastine (chair), M. Olleck, T. Brannow.

1. The proposed franchise agreement with Pinewharf Eateries was reviewed. Legal confirmed the draft aligns with standard terms; exclusivity for the Harlowe Valley region remains open.
2. Olleck to finalise fee schedule by month end.
3. Brannow raised staffing implications; deferred to next session.
4. The board approved proceeding to final negotiation.

Attached below for board eyes only is the confidential note on forward plans.

board note of fahag-tajop: The eastern region missed its Julix quota by 44.0 percent last quarter. Ralionax Holdings plans to lower the Druath list price by 61.8 percent in March. The board signed off on a budget of $295.0 million for Project Gilath. The renewal with Ruswynix Systems closes at $274.5 million a year, 17.0 percent above the last contract.